Transaction 4098c95b1677abfbc328ca19de54376749f36a287d20daf57357d0acb4c7e569
1 Input
1 Output
-
4098c95b1677abfbc328ca19de54376749f36a287d20daf57357d0acb4c7e569:0
- value
- 2543680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be9981e9606c091367048de2dc04c5a9037cbfb OP_EQUAL
- address
- 3MjojxwdFZ2BtcwZWtsxPi1sJKaKuXxmps